Hi all,

Have you guys encountered any trouble in retrieving your DS-160? My son was finished filling up the form and when he was uploading his photo, the page timed out. He tried retrieving it but there was an error:

  • Surname does not match.
  • Year of Birth does not match.
  • The answer for the security question is incorrect.

He is so sure that he was entering the right info. Is this a recurring problem? He used Mozilla FireFox and also tried Google Chrome and Internet Explorer, but to no avail.

  On 11/10/2015 at 12:03 PM, Mydy said:

Hi all (F) !

Hope everyone is having a good day.. or night!

I have called US Embassy yesterday and have scheduled my interview on Dec. 7th. My fiancee and I were hoping to schedule it within November but the embassy said they don't have any open slot for this month anymore.

I have already filled out the DS-160 but havent clicked "SIGN" yet because there are some questions that I'm unsure of what answer to put in there. I have called the US Embassy and asked the customer service for help but she declined..

So I am here again.. I need your help to make me understand.. pretty please. I just want to make sure that I am not just putting unnecessary answers to questions that I don't even need to answer.

1. Marital Status - my previous marriage was already annulled but the drop down from that question doesn't have the word "Annulled" in the list. Will it be safe to click on "DIVORCED" or "OTHERS" instead?

2. National Identification Number - should I just put my Tax Identification Number here?

3. Passport Book Number - I'm lost. I know that this is different from the passport number.

4. US Point of contact info - Fiancee? My mom told me we have relatives living in the states but she doesn't even know their names (lol) so maybe it is safe to click "no"?

5. Vaccinations - should I just click Yes and just refer to St. Luke's documentations after my medical?

6. Other names used - I dont have any aliases but how about my married name? I used my ex husband's family name when my marriage was not yet annulled.

I am kinda confused (yet, again).. maybe I am just nervous and I am scared that my application will be denied just because I did not understand and I made a mistake. I put everything to the best of my knowledge in that form and I just want to make sure that I understood every questions before I click "Sign".

Thank you in advance!

  On 3/20/2017 at 11:41 AM, MsMorena said:

Hi,  i would like to ask what did you put on your Marital Status? Because my marriage was also annulled before, .i really dont know what to put on it? Please help me..thank you so much

Expand  

You are chasing the K-1 visa, you better to single.

 

Annulment "removes" the marriage.
